On 2017-10-30 17:25:05 +0000, simon.giesecke@btc-ag.com wrote:

It would be really useful for a user community to contribute to the
documentation that is generated using Doxygen, if the generated HTML output
contained direct links into e.g. the Bitbucket editor to the corresponding
source file. For example, when I have a generated HTML page showing the
documentation of a class X whose documentation is in a file X.hpp, the HTML
page should contain a link to an associated Bitbucket instance that allow to
directly edit X.hpp and create a pull request for that change.

This is analogous to what the new Microsoft documentation does. For example
https://docs.microsoft.com/en-us/cpp/build/reference/std-specify-language-
standard-version has a link to https://github.com/Microsoft/cpp-
docs/blob/master/docs/build/reference/std-specify-language-standard-
version.md

This should be pretty similar regardless of whether Bitbucket, GitHub or
GitLab (or something similar) is the target.
